From page 24 of 1889-1890 catalog: Style 915, 225 GUIS, Code "Glaringly" with Pipe Top (2nd page in cataolog)
Have original bench, missing pedalboard assembly, external blower and metal rod that fits on lower right hand side of organ when facing the organ
Length of lower unit is 5 ft (with blower attached is 6 ft 2 inches - missing the blower
Depth is 2 ft 9 inches (with pedals 4 ft 2 inches and height is 5 ft). It has the original bench.
Organ has the pipe top which is shown on the 2nd page of the catalog. It is just for show but looks wonderful.
The organ has 4 foot "pedals" near the pedalboard which are labeled from left to right as Grand Organ, Pedal Coupler, missing label, and Manual Swell.
Above and in the center from the pedalboard is one Knee Swell and it is labeled "Knee Swell"
